Attractions in Nebraska on the USA Map

Despite its reputation, Nebraska has a lot to offer for tourists. Outdoor enthusiasts can explore the stunning rock formations at Chimney Rock National Historic Site, hike the trails at Scotts Bluff National Monument, or witness the annual migration of sandhill cranes along the Platte River. For history buffs, the state boasts numerous museums and historic sites, including the Strategic Air Command & Aerospace Museum and the Homestead National Monument.

Local Culture in Nebraska on the USA Map

Nebraska’s local culture is deeply rooted in its agricultural heritage, with farming and ranching playing a significant role in the state’s economy. Visitors can experience this firsthand by attending a rodeo, visiting a farm or ranch, or sampling local cuisine like steak and corn on the cob.

Hidden Gems in Nebraska on the USA Map

One of Nebraska’s hidden gems is the Sandhills region, a vast expanse of sand dunes and grasslands that is home to a unique ecosystem and abundant wildlife. Another lesser-known attraction is the Carhenge monument, a quirky tribute to Stonehenge made entirely out of cars.

FAQs about Nebraska on the USA Map

Q: What is the best time of year to visit Nebraska?

A: The best time to visit Nebraska depends on your interests. Outdoor enthusiasts may prefer the spring or fall, when temperatures are mild and the natural scenery is at its most vibrant. Summer is also a popular time to visit, especially for events like state fairs and rodeos. Winter can be cold and snowy, but it’s also a great time for winter sports like skiing and snowshoeing.

Q: What are some must-see attractions in Nebraska?

A: Some of Nebraska’s must-see attractions include Chimney Rock National Historic Site, Scotts Bluff National Monument, the Strategic Air Command & Aerospace Museum, and the Homestead National Monument. The state also has a number of charming small towns and scenic byways worth exploring.

Q: What is Nebraska known for?

A: Nebraska is known for its agricultural heritage, with farming and ranching playing a significant role in the state’s economy. It is also home to several notable landmarks and cultural institutions, including Chimney Rock, Carhenge, and the Henry Doorly Zoo and Aquarium.

Q: What is the weather like in Nebraska?

A: Nebraska has a continental climate with hot summers and cold winters. Temperatures can vary widely depending on the time of year and location within the state. Spring and fall tend to be mild and pleasant, while summer can be hot and humid. Winter can bring cold temperatures and snowfall, especially in the northern and western parts of the state.
